Solar panel bird wire, also known as bird deterrent wire, is a simple yet effective solution to prevent birds from nesting or perching on solar panels. It acts as a barrier that discourages birds from accessing the panels, thus reducing the risk of damage to the panels and protecting the well-being of these creatures.

Protecting wildlife and maximizing solar energy production
Solar panel bird wire offers a win-win solution, addressing both wildlife protection and solar energy production. By installing bird deterrent wire, installers can reduce the likelihood of birds nesting or perching on the panels, preserving their integrity and performance.
Solar panel bird wire is typically made of stainless steel or similar durable materials. It is specifically designed to be thin and barely noticeable, ensuring it does not obstruct sunlight from reaching the panels. The wire is installed using specialized clips and tensioning systems, making it virtually impossible for birds to find a comfortable place to perch, build a nest, or roost.
Benefits of solar panel bird wire:
1. Bird protection: By preventing birds from accessing solar panels, the bird deterrent wire helps protect them from potential injuries or fatalities caused by electrocution, collisions, or entrapment.
2. Energy efficiency: Bird droppings or nesting materials can decrease the efficiency of solar panels, reducing the amount of energy they produce. By deterring birds, bird wire helps maximize solar energy output and ensures optimal performance.
3. Cost-effective solution: Installing bird deterrent wire is a cost-effective way to protect solar panels. Rather than risking potential damage and loss of efficiency, incorporating bird wire from the start can save significant maintenance and repair costs down the line.
